Abstract
The utility model discloses a portable type hand-powered operating electrical appliance comprising a hand-powered generator; two output electrodes of the hand-powered generator are connected with a rectifier filter in parallel; two output electrodes of the rectifier filter are connected with an integrated voltage regulator in parallel; two output electrodes of the integrated voltage regulator are in parallel connected with a luminous body and a second switch body which are connected with each other in series; two output electrodes of the integrated voltage regulator are also connected with a USB interface in parallel; the hand-powered generator is taken as a generator, which has simple structure and convenient and fast production; the output end of the generator is configured with various types of controllable luminous bodies, USB interfaces and the like, thus having various applications; and the output end of the generator is also configured with a power body, if the generator can not work, the power body can work, thus ensuring the continuous duty of the whole appliance.

Embodiment
Embodiment describes in further detail the utility model below in conjunction with accompanying drawing.
As shown in Figure 1, figure grade is described as follows: hand-rail type generator 1, rectifier filter 2, integrated regulator 3, luminous element L, second switch body K2, the first switch body K1, power source body U, USB interface.
The utility model embodiment, portable hand controlling electric device comprises hand-rail type generator 1, is parallel with rectifier filter 2 on two output stages of this hand-rail type generator 1, is parallel with integrated regulator 3 on two output stages of this rectifier filter 2; Be parallel with the luminous element L and the second switch body K2 that are in series on two output stages of integrated regulator 3; Also be parallel with USB interface on two output stages of integrated regulator 3.
Present embodiment is achieved in that on two output stages of integrated regulator 3 and also is parallel with the power source body U and the first switch body K1 that is in series.
First kind of execution mode of power source body U is: power source body U is a dry cell, and the magnitude of voltage of this dry cell is five volts.
Second kind of execution mode of power source body U is: power source body U is a lithium ion battery, and the magnitude of voltage of this lithium ion battery is five volts.
Power source body U is anodal to be matched mutually with the positive pole of hand-rail type generator 1, and correspondingly, described power source body U negative pole matches mutually with the negative pole of hand-rail type generator 1.
Hand-rail type generator 1, rectifier filter 2, integrated regulator 3 outsourcings are provided with housing, and compass also is installed on the described housing.
Luminous element L, second switch body K2, power source body U and the first switch body K1 also are installed on the housing.
First kind of mode of operation of the present utility model is: use pattern as flashlight; Disconnect the first switch body K1, close second switch body K2, manual hand-rail type generator 1, this hand-rail type generator 1 convert kinetic energy to electric energy, 5 volts the direct current that obtains after handling through rectifier filter 2, integrated regulator 3, and the work of lighting luminous element L.
Second kind of mode of operation of the present utility model is: be built-in power body U charge mode; Close the first switch body K1, disconnect second switch body K2, manual hand-rail type generator 1, this hand-rail type generator 1 convert kinetic energy to electric energy, 5 volts the direct current that obtains after handling through rectifier filter 2, integrated regulator 3, and power source body U charged.
The third mode of operation of the present utility model is: be outside cell-phone charging pattern one; Disconnect the first switch body K1, disconnect second switch body K2, manual hand-rail type generator 1, this hand-rail type generator 1 convert kinetic energy to electric energy, 5 volts the direct current that after rectifier filter 2, integrated regulator 3 handled, obtains, and the mobile phone of USB interface charged.
The 4th kind of mode of operation of the present utility model is: be outside cell-phone charging pattern two; Close the first switch body K1, disconnect second switch body K2, charge by the mobile phone of U power source body to USB interface.
Advantage of the present utility model is: the motor that adopts hand-rail type is as generator, and it is simple in structure, and it is convenient to make; Dispose multiple controlled luminous element, USB interface etc. on the output of generator, it serves many purposes; Output at generator also disposes power source body U, if in idle while of generator, this power source body U also can work, and has guaranteed the continuous operation of whole utensil.
